The controllable margin plus the additional income, and the average operating assets plus the new machine must be used in to determine the new ROI. Dax Pet Foods compiled the following information for the year for its dog divisionAverage operating assets $3,500,000 Controllable margin 315,000

Current ROI = Controllable Margin/Average Operating Assets = 315000/3500000 = 9%
If the new machine is bought, ROI will change to = (315000 + 19500)/(3500000 + 150000) = 9.16%
Option B (It will increase to 9.16%) is correct.
